Indoor Positioning Services Location Based Recommendations Jim Hahn
Indoor Positioning Services + Location Based Recommendations Jim Hahn jimhahn@illinois. edu
Wayfinder 2
Estimote Beacons 3
Beacon Components http: //blog. estimote. com/post/57087851702/preorder-for-estimote-beaconsavailable-shipping 4
Goals + Objectives • Computing processes used to integrate beacons into app – Components for the recommendation algorithm • Testing and improving beacon precision – Securing location based services 5
Integrating Beacons to App 6
Math Emergency: Trilateration 7
Modular APIs 8
Recommendations Processing 9
Recommendations Processing 10
Beacon Locations 11
Beacon Awareness Tests 12
Beacon Testing 13
Security: Estimote Cloud https: //community. estimote. com/hc/enus/articles/201371053 -What-security-features-does. Estimote-offer-How-does-Secure-UUID-work 14
Securing Local DB 15
Securing Local DB 16
Conclusion + Project Next Steps • Look for Wayfinder update to the Minrva app on Android Play store this Summer 2016. • Updates from Technology Prototyping Projects Page: http: //sif. library. illinois. edu 17
Acknowledgements • Ben Ryckman, Lead Developer • Maria Lux, Graphic Designer • Senior Projects Course Team Sr. Proj CS 492/493 – Ben Blaisdell, Christopher Collins, Maxx Macica, Raymond Farias, Yier Huang • The author wishes to acknowledge the Research and Publication Committee of the University of Illinois at Urbana. Champaign Library, which provided support for the completion of this research. 18
Estimote Resources • Developer Docs, including Beacon Tech Overview: http: //developer. estimote. com/ • Reality Matters: How do beacons work? The physics of beacon tech: http: //blog. estimote. com/post/106913675010 /how-do-beacons-work-the-physics-of-beacontech 19
- Slides: 19